Salary range: $17-$35/hr

Job type: Full time/part time

Location: Hybrid (Edmonton, AB & Wetaskiwin, AB)

Job Description: Q-Block Computing is seeking an Administrative Assistant to join our team in Canada. This role offers an exciting opportunity to contribute to the development of cutting-edge quantum science and technology by supporting the efficient and effective operation of our business. 

Job summary: As an Administrative Assistant, you will collaborate with other team members and perform administrative tasks under the guidance of senior leaders. Job duty includes the administrative & clerical activities, review & preparation of templates, reports, PowerPoint & Words documents, Excel workbooks, minute recording, scheduling, and research & compilation of information. You will contribute to the development of new ideas and approaches to improve work processes.

Responsibilities

  • Administrative and clerical activities
  • Review and prepare general templates, letters, and reports
  • Review and prepare PowerPoint and Word documents, Excel workbook and other correspondence materials
  • Project expense recording
  • Research and compile information/data as applicable
  • Manage and coordinate multiple calendars
  • Coordinate and schedule internal and external meetings
  • Manage meeting minutes
  • Coordinate travel arrangements and reservations

Qualification

  • Post-secondary education in administration

Skills

  • Excellent organization and time management skills with the ability to manage multiple tasks simultaneously
  • Strong attention to detail, authenticity, and a sense of responsibility in all tasks
  • Strong interpersonal skills and the ability to work collaborative in a dynamic team environment

Benefits

  • Extended health care benefits (inc. dental and vision)
  • Life insurance

What you need to know about the Calgary Tech Scene

Employees can spend up to one-third of their life at work, so choosing the right company is crucial, not just for the job itself but for the company culture as well. While startups often offer dynamic culture and growth opportunities, large corporations provide benefits like career development and networking, especially appealing to recent graduates. Fortunately, Calgary stands out as a hub for both, recognized as one of Startup Genome's Top 100 Emerging Ecosystems, while also playing host to a number of multinational enterprises. In Calgary, job seekers can find a wide range of opportunities.
